2.2: Typing in file-list doesn't change file in editor


  • Subject: 2.2: Typing in file-list doesn't change file in editor
  • From: Tor Langballe <email@hidden>
  • Date: Mon, 30 Jan 2006 21:58:40 -0800

Sorry if this has been covered, can't find a good way to search for it thru my digest mode emails.

I'm focused in the file list (the one with code size etc), and I've got my editor buildt in below.
If I move in the list with the arrow keys, or click on a file with the mouse, the editor shows this file.
If I type the first letters of the file name, the list jumps down to the correct file, but the editor doesn't show it!!!


This worked file before 2.2.

This is really annoying, as my whole non-mouse setup falls appart, or I have to open the file in a new window or go up/down after typing the filename.
Does anybody know a way around this?
